Medicare Basics

Medicare is a federal health insurance program that provides coverage for individuals aged 65 and older. It consists of different parts, including Part A (hospital insurance), Part B (medical insurance), Part C (Medicare Advantage), and Part D (prescription drug coverage). While gym memberships are not covered under the original Medicare (Parts A and B), certain Medicare Advantage plans (Part C) and some Medicare Supplement plans provide additional fitness and gym benefits.

Review Your Medicare Plan

Medicare Advantage Plans: Check your plan's Summary of Benefits to find out if they provide access to a fitness club or gym membership benefit. A few of the most common programs are:
Medicare Supplement Plans: Depending on the type of plan you selected, you may have a gym or fitness membership included. For example, many AARP/UHC plans include a free membership to

Renew Active

. Other plans may offer an option to add fitness or gym benefits for an additional fee. For example, Mutual of Omaha's

Mutually Well

program is $25 monthly.

Understand Fitness Benefits

Once you verify that your plan has a fitness benefit, familiarize yourself with what's included. These benefits can vary depending on the plan and may include access to participating gyms, fitness classes, personal trainers, or home fitness programs. Some plans may require you to use specific fitness facilities, while others may offer more flexibility in choosing your preferred gym.

Find Participating Gyms

After understanding the fitness benefits of your Medicare Advantage plan, identify the gyms and fitness centers that participate in your plan's network. Check the plan's website or call the Member Services number on your ID card to request a list of participating facilities in your area. Make sure to choose a conveniently located gym that offers the amenities and equipment you desire.

Activate Your Membership

Once you have selected a participating gym, follow the instructions provided by your plan to activate your free gym membership. This may involve contacting the gym directly or completing an online registration process. Be sure to have your plan details and Medicare ID card on hand to provide the necessary information during enrollment.
